|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
21.11.2010, 15:14 | #1 |
Пользователь
Регистрация: 17.10.2009
Сообщений: 46
|
Прроблемы с шифрованием
ну есть код для шифрования со сдвигом, но он сдвигает не впределах одного алфавита, а по ходу по всей ASCII, скажите как в с++ сделать, чтоб он понимал тока малые буквы лат. алфавита или как его ограничить и да почему не правильно когда пишишь
Код:
|
21.11.2010, 16:11 | #2 |
Форумчанин
Регистрация: 26.03.2010
Сообщений: 538
|
то есть вы хотите чтобы шифрованию подвергались только строчные латинские буквы и шифровались бы они тоже только строчными латинскими буквами?
Единственный способ стать умнее - играть с более умным противником.
|
21.11.2010, 16:16 | #3 |
Пользователь
Регистрация: 17.10.2009
Сообщений: 46
|
именно так
|
21.11.2010, 16:22 | #4 |
Пользователь
Регистрация: 17.10.2009
Сообщений: 46
|
у меня вообще то теперь только не работает, когда какая либо из букв шифруемого слова будет Z? как исправить?
|
21.11.2010, 16:23 | #5 | |
Форумчанин
Регистрация: 26.03.2010
Сообщений: 538
|
Можно реализовать так:
Функция, которая принимает код символа и если сивол является строчной латинской буквой, то шифрует его, если не является-оставляет без изменений Код:
Код:
Цитата:
Единственный способ стать умнее - играть с более умным противником.
Последний раз редактировалось Sam Gold; 21.11.2010 в 16:26. |
|
21.11.2010, 16:35 | #6 |
Старожил
Регистрация: 21.03.2009
Сообщений: 2,193
|
Могу предложить свой вариант шифрования
Простые и красивые программы - коды программ + учебник C++
Создание игры - взгляд изнутри - сайт проекта Тема на форуме, посвященная ему же |
21.11.2010, 16:36 | #7 |
Пользователь
Регистрация: 17.10.2009
Сообщений: 46
|
|
21.11.2010, 16:39 | #8 | |
Пользователь
Регистрация: 17.10.2009
Сообщений: 46
|
Цитата:
|
|
21.11.2010, 17:07 | #9 | |
Форумчанин
Регистрация: 26.03.2010
Сообщений: 538
|
Цитата:
Единственный способ стать умнее - играть с более умным противником.
|
|
21.11.2010, 17:54 | #10 |
Пользователь
Регистрация: 17.10.2009
Сообщений: 46
|
Sam Gold, спасибо, разобрался, но сделал все по своему)
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Помогите с Шифрованием на С++ | Сергей Человек | Общие вопросы C/C++ | 0 | 29.11.2009 16:03 |
Помогите пожалуйста с шифрованием! | AnutkaSolnce | Помощь студентам | 5 | 19.05.2007 21:32 |